数据交换平台的任务调度模型设计
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
数据交换平台的任务调度模型设计
随着信息技术的快速发展,数据交换变得越来越重要。
在每个企业都需要交换数据的情况下,数据交换平台已成为每家企业必须部署的基础设施之一。
然而,数据交换是一个非常复杂的问题,因为不同系统之间的数据格式和交换规则都不相同。
为了解决这个问题,需要设计一个可靠的任务调度模型,以确保数据能够在不同系统之间快速、高效、安全地进行交换。
在设计任务调度模型时,需要考虑以下几个因素:
1. 数据交换的类型:
数据交换可以分为多种类型,其中包括文件传输、数据转换、数据抽取、数据加载等。
为了设计一个有效的调度模型,需要首先确定所需的数据交换类型。
2. 数据交换频率:
不同的企业需要不同的数据交换频率。
有些企业需要每天甚至每小时进行数据交换,而有些企业可能只需要每周或每月进行一次。
因此,在设计任务调度模型时,需要考虑不同企业的数据交换需求和频率。
3. 数据交换的目标:
在每个交换任务中,需要指定数据的来源和目标。
数据交换的目标可能是内部系统、外部系统、供应商或客户。
在设计任务
调度模型时,需要确定数据交换的目标,以便为每个交换任务分配适当的资源。
4. 数据交换的优先级:
每个交换任务都有不同的优先级。
一些数据可能很重要且需要优先交换,而其他数据可能可以等待更长时间。
在设计任务调度模型时,需要为不同的交换任务分配不同的优先级,以确保最重要的数据交换任务能够及时完成。
基于以上因素,任务调度模型应遵循以下原则:
1. 可配置性:
任务调度模型应该是可配置和可扩展的。
它应该允许管理员对不同的交换任务进行配置,并应对不同的数据交换需求作出适当的响应。
2. 时间触发:
任务调度模型应该能够按照预定的时间自动执行不同的数据交换任务。
这意味着调度模型必须能够自动将任务分配给适当的资源,并在指定的时间内完成交换任务。
3. 优先级处理:
任务调度模型应该考虑不同交换任务的优先级。
它应该能够自动将高优先级任务分配给高速资源,以便在最短时间内完成交
换任务。
4. 错误处理:
由于数据交换的复杂性,任务调度模型必须能够处理错误情况。
例如,如果数据格式不正确或数据传输失败,任务调度模型应该能够自动处理并重新执行交换任务,以确保数据交换的可靠性和稳定性。
总之,任务调度模型是数据交换平台的重要组成部分。
在设计和实施中需要考虑许多因素,以确保数据交换的可靠性和高效性。
只有在合理规划和有效的设计下,任务调度模型才能实现其预期效果。